- The distance between Kerkira, Greece and Farafra, Egypt is approximately 1,583 km or 984 mi.
- To reach Kerkira in this distance one would set out from Farafra bearing 333.9° or NNW and follow the great circles arc to approach Kerkira bearing 329.4° or NNW .
- Kerkira has a Mediterranean hot climate (Csa) whereas Farafra has a subtropical hot desert climate (BWh).
- The annual average temperature is 4.6 °C (8.2°F) cooler.
- Average monthly temperatures vary by 1.5 °C (2.7°F) less in Kerkira. The continentality subtype is truly oceanic as opposed to semicontinental.
- Total annual precipitation averages 1085.3 mm (42.7 in) more which is equivalent to 1085.3 l/m² (26.64 US gal/ft²) or 10,853,000 l/ha (1,160,258 US gal/ac) more. About 543 2/3 as much.
- The altitude of the sun at midday is overall 12.5° lower in Kerkira than in Farafra.
- Relative humidity levels are 32.2% higher.
- The mean dew point temperature is 5.4°C (9.6°F) higher.
